We currently seek to fill the position of Director of Administration.

Fundamental Objective:

  • The Director of Administration performs high level administrative support activities for multiple department leaders, including the General Manager and President. This position will direct the entire administrative department working closely with HEC executive staff and department managers to provide reports, spreadsheets, word processing, and workflow monitoring. This key position will oversee the intricacies of all the administrative processes within the business unit through communication, analysis, organization coordination and process improvement

Essential Functions:

  • Create spreadsheets and database reports to provide managers and executive staff relevant and timely information to improve business efficiency.
  • Present financial statements, earnings or activity reports, or other performance data to measure productivity or goal achievement or to identify areas needing cost reduction or process improvement.

*

  • Assist company executives in coordinating activities of the business or departments concerned with the production, pricing, sales, or distribution of products.
  • Gather, generate, and provide information to control budgets for business operations, equipment, personnel, and supplies.
  • Assist executive staff in the coordination of financial or budget activities to fund operations, maximize investments, or increase efficiency.
  • Confer with business leaders on the development of production schedules or work orders to departments.
  • Compile and prepare documentation related to production sequences, transportation, personnel schedules, or purchase, maintenance, or repair orders, to determine best course of action.
  • Assist in projects that will create greater efficiencies (i.e. conversion to a primary paperless work environment, work orders, billing, field operation forms etc.)
  • Help analyze and interpret financial, operational and production data.
  • Direct administrative activities directly related to supporting field operations and all other business activities.
  • Monitor assignments, deadlines and progress of multiple projects within assigned division to ensure accountability between the entire business unit.
  • Serve as the primary contact for device management to all staff. Maintain and provide all IT equipment for the organization; provide telephone or tablet support related to networking or connectivity issues; perform routine maintenance or standard repairs to IT equipment; and assist on all technology matters as directed.
  • Attend monthly management staff meetings as directed.
  • Provide support to executives in the creation and management of the annual capital expense budget.
  • Primary contact in all dealings with the company’s financial institution for financing new equipment purchases/lease program.

Work closely with sister companies as needed so that the appropriate continuity is provided
